Franklite/Christopher Hyde
Britlist nominations open

Hertfordshire

/ 20.02.2017

The Grove, Hertfordshire

‘20 miles from central London…’. Think of that radius and you likely imagine yourself still amongst the concrete jungle of Greater London. But with…